YO24 1AE is a residential postcode situated on Blossom Street, York, YO24 with 5 addresses.
It ranks as the 49th largest and 198th most expensive of the 654 postcodes in the YO24 area. The dominant property type is a period flat built between 1800 and 1911.
The postcode contains a total of 5 properties: 5 flats.
Sale prices range from £129,030 for 1 bedroom leasehold flats (344 ft2) to £276,535 for 3 bedroom Leasehold flats with a garden (1,205 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£657 pcm for 1 bed flats to £1,162 pcm for 3 bed flats.
The gross rental yield is between 5.0% and 6.1%.
The average value per square foot is £234.
